Job Title: Approved Electrician Location: Ashford, Kent Salary : Up to £20.63 per hour - depending on skills and experience Job Type: Permanent, Full time Closing Date: 22nd March 2026 About the Role: We are looking an enthusiastic qualified approved electrician to complement our existing direct services team and join our electrical services division. The role will principally involve periodic electrical installation condition reports, refurbishments and repairs to electrical installations. About you: The ideal candidate will: Have an all-round knowledge and experience of electrical installations and the wiring regulations together with the right demeanour for working as a team and in occupied properties. Be conscientious, quality driven and well organised. Be computer literate Have good communication skills and be committed to providing a high-quality service to our tenants Candidates should hold the qualifications of: BS7671 (Current Edition) City & Guilds Level 3 2391: 2391-52 Initial Verification & Periodic Inspection and Testing 2391-51 Periodic Inspection of Electrical Installations 2391-50 Initial Verification of Electrical Installations You will need to hold a current valid driving licence as a company van will be provided. Job Title: Compliance Manager Location: Ashford, Kent Salary : £58,488 to £63,225 per annum Job Type: Full time, Permanent Working Hours: 37 hour per week Closing Date: 2nd November 2025 About The Role: We are seeking a highly skilled and motivated Compliance Manager to lead our Compliance Team in delivering safe, high-quality housing across the borough. This is a pivotal role in supporting our commitment to affordable housing and carbon reduction, ensuring our housing stock meets all statutory and regulatory standards. Key Responsibilities: You will be responsible for overseeing all major and minor compliance areas, including: Fire Safety Gas Safety Electrical Safety Water Hygiene Lift Maintenance Asbestos Management Along with ensuring that all buildings are safe, compliant, and supported by up-to-date statutory documentation you will be expected to implement cyclical testing, servicing, and maintenance programmes as well as: Leading procurement of compliance contracts and specialist testing services. Maintaining accurate records using MRI Asset Management and True Compliance systems. Providing strategic reports, and responding to complaints and FOIs. About you: To be competent in this role it is essential that you have - Chartered membership of a relevant professional body (e.g., CIBSE, RICS, MCIOB) along with: BOHS P405 Asbestos Management qualification. NEBOSH Level 6 Fire Safety in Construction. Training in ACOP L8, HSG274, and gas safety regulations. Proven experience managing a Compliance Team and overseeing all six major compliance areas. Strong understanding of CDM regulations and M&E systems. Excellent communication, leadership, and contract management skills.
